The journey from Wigton to Chester is approximately 130 miles. The most practical way is by train, involving changes at Carlisle and Crewe to reach Chester. Driving takes about 3 hours via the M6. Chester is a historic city famous for its Roman walls and medieval architecture. This route connects the Cumbrian countryside to the heart of Cheshire.
